/**
* @assertion Finally, the conditional [?]/[:] operator only evaluates one of
* its branches, depending on whether the condition expression evaluates to
* [true] or [false]. The other branch must also be a potentially constant
* expression.
* @description Checks that conditional operator [?]/[:] rejects the second
* operand if condition is [true] for constant expressions.
* @author iarkh@unipro.ru
*/
import "../../Utils/expect.dart";
main() {
const str = true ? "OK" : (null as String).length < 14;
Expect.equals("OK", str);
const String str1 = true ? "OK" : "wrong";
Expect.equals("OK", str1);
}
